Citizens Charter
The Vision and Mission Statement in respect of Film and Television Institute of India, Pune, is enclosed as Annexure-I.
1.  Details of Business transacted by the Organization :
  The main business transacted by the Institute is to impart training to the students in the art and craft of filmmaking and offer in-service training to the personnel from Doordarshan. The detailed objectives of the Institute are enclosed as Annexure-II. A copy of Prospectus for the year 2006 is also available on this website.
   
2.  Details/types of Clients/Customers
  The main clients/customers of the Institute are film and television course students, TV trainees deputed by Doordarshan and Outside Producers of Film and TV Production houses.
   
3.  Expectations from the client/citizen
  The students and TV trainees expect systematic training in the art and craft of Film and TV media. The Outside Producers' expectations are limited to timely provision of good quality equipment, trained technicians and suitable locations for their Film and TV productions, at reasonable rates. The in-service training offers opportunity of interaction and exchange of ideas among DD employees and augmenting their skills and exposure to the new technical aspects of the medium.

5.  Spell out standards of service i.e. indicate time-limits for execution of various tasks involving public interface and the quality of service with reference to courtesy and helpfulness of the staff
  Being an educational institution, the main services of the Institute involve training for film and television students enrolled in the Diploma courses and the One Year Certificate Course in Television and Doordarshan and TV trainees. The syllabi for the various courses are designed by the Academic Council that consists of media professionals and teachers. The courses have fixed duration which are arrived at after provision of training in all important ingredients of Film, Television and allied subjects. The teachers are appointed as per the standards of qualifications and experience set by the Governing Council. The short Courses vary in their duration from 2 weeks to 8 weeks.

The Institute consists of two Wings : the Film and the TV Wing. The FTII offers the following Courses
I.  Three year Post Graduate Diploma in Film & Television with following four specializations
a) Direction
b) Cinematography
c) Editing
d) Sound Recording & Sound Design
   
II.  Two year Post Graduate Diploma in Film Acting.
   
III.  Two year Post Graduate Diploma in Art Direction and Production Design.
   
IV.  One Year Post Graduate Certificate Course in Television with following four specialization
a) TV Direction;
b) Electronic Cinematography;
c) Video Editing;
d) Sound Recording and TV Engineering
   
V.  One year Post Graduate Certificate Course in Feature Film Screenplay Writing.
   
VI.  One and half Year Certificate Course in Animation and Computer Graphics.
The TV Wing also conducts in-service training courses for the personnel of Doordarshan covering all categories of staff in TV Production, Technical Operations, Editing, Sound Recording, Camera, Graphics and Set Design etc.
12 Weeks Course in TV Production and Technical Operations for DD Staff.
